A circular walk of 7 miles starting from the impressive Mount St Bernard Abbey on woodland paths, tarmac tracks and fields with limited road walking. The path crosses a bridge over Blackbrook Reservoir and passes lots of impressive buildings including a windmill. There are one or two manageable ups and downs, which with good weather will provide stunning views. There are no stiles. A couple of paths on the route need care - deeply rutted or stoney.

There is the opportunity to explore the abbey on return to the car park. The abbey has a tea room which is a 2 minute drive down the road with impressive food and drink.

The car park has toilets that can be accessed before and after the walk.
